Front Garden Design For Rock Gardens

If you're a homeowner who is looking for a way to spruce up your front or backyard, a rock garden may be the perfect solution. Not only do these low-maintenance gardens add visual appeal to your landscape, but they can also help keep weeds at bay and conserve water. If you're interested in creating a rock garden for your home, read on for our tips and tricks!

How to Create a Rock Garden

Creating a rock garden is a relatively simple process that can usually be done in a weekend. Here's how:

Step 1: Choose a Location

The first step in creating a rock garden is to choose a location for it. Ideally, you'll want to choose a spot that gets plenty of sunlight and is relatively flat. Avoid areas that are too steep or that have poor drainage, as this can cause water to pool and kill your plants.

Step 2: Clear the Area

Once you've chosen your location, it's time to clear the area. Remove any grass, weeds, or debris from the space, and make sure the ground is level.

Step 3: Add Rocks

Next, it's time to add your rocks. Start by placing larger rocks at the bottom of the garden, and then work your way up with smaller rocks until you reach the top. Be sure to leave enough space between the rocks for your plants to grow.

Step 4: Choose your Plants

Once your rocks are in place, it's time to choose your plants. Look for plants that are suited to your climate and that can thrive in rocky soil. Some popular choices include succulents, sedums, and cacti.

Step 5: Plant your Garden

Finally, it's time to plant your garden. Dig holes for each of your plants, being careful not to disturb the rocks around them. Once you've planted your plants, add a layer of mulch around them to help retain moisture.

Tips & Tricks for Creating a Successful Rock Garden

Now that you know how to create a rock garden, here are some tips and tricks to help ensure its success:

  • Choose rocks that are native to your area to help your garden blend in with its surroundings.
  • Consider adding a small water feature or fountain to your garden to create a soothing ambiance.
  • Try to choose plants that have similar water and sunlight requirements to make maintenance easier.
  • Consider using weed barriers or landscaping fabric to help prevent weeds from growing in your garden.
  • Be sure to properly space your plants to allow them room to grow and thrive.
  • If you're unsure about which plants to choose, consider consulting with a professional landscaper for guidance.

By following these tips and tricks, you can create a beautiful, low-maintenance rock garden that will enhance the beauty of your home for years to come!
